Upside
Technology
BackendEngineer
Neural analysis suggests this role is
optimal for mid candidates.
“Backend Engineer at Upside. Skills: Backend development, Applied AI, Agentic AI. Build scalable backend systems. Maintain scalable backend systems”
What You'll Achieve.
Build and scale platforms; Ensure architecture performs
Industry & Context.
Proactive problem solving; Optimize systems
What They're Looking For.
Must Have
2+ years commercial experience, Solid understanding OOP, Solid understanding clean code, Solid understanding SDLC, Practical SQL knowledge, Practical relational databases knowledge, PostgreSQL knowledge, Git experience, Docker experience, CI/CD pipelines experience, Proactive mindset, Curious mindset, Ready to take ownership, Use AI tools, Great command English
Nice to Have
Python experience, Ruby experience, AWS experience, Kubernetes experience
What You'll Do.
Build scalable backend systems
Maintain scalable backend systems
Identify issues early
Propose optimizations
Work with stakeholders
Translate requirements
Share lessons learned
Support AI integration
How You'll Work.
Team & Collaboration
Cross-functional teams; Autonomous teams; High-performing team
Communication Scope
Written English; Spoken English
Full Job Description
[Upside](https://upsidelab.io/) is a software consultancy built by engineers, for engineers. We partner with global companies to solve real, complex technical challenges. We’re deep into Applied AI and R&D, building both production-grade platforms for clients and our own open-source tools like [Enthusiast](https://github.com/upsidelab/enthusiast) (Agentic AI framework). We operate in a Forward-Deployed model. We don’t sit behind a wall of specs or wait for the tickets. We get into the trenches with the client, identify the actual challenges, and take full ownership of the solution. Our teams are small (3–9 people), autonomous, and cross-functional. #### What it means for you You won’t be assigned to a random project. You’ll partner directly with founders and CTOs on technical decisions, shaping systems - not just implementing them. You’ll have the autonomy to choose the right tools and the ownership to ensure the architecture performs under pressure.Your focus stays where it counts: mission-critical logic and high-impact experiments, not repetitive tasks and countless meetings. We don't do "safe or predictable". You’ll contribute to strategic open-source projects and build AI-driven solutions. #### Role Overview As a Backend Engineer, you’ll be integral to building and scaling platforms for our global clients. You’ll join a high-performing team where your voice matters. You’ll design and implement resilient systems while staying close to the code, bringing solutions to the table instead of just reporting problems. #### Responsibilities * Technical Execution: Build and maintain scalable backend systems with a focus on clean, maintainable code. * Proactive Problem Solving: Identify issues early and propose actionable ways to fix or optimize them. * Collaboration: Work closely with the team and stakeholders to translate requirements into working technology. * Knowledge Sharing: Share your findings and lessons learned from the code to help the team grow. * AI Implementa
Applying for this Backend Engineer role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
ANONYMOUS · UNFILTERED
What do employees actually say about Upside?
Real rants from real employees. Read before you apply.